Not quite of Germanic origin; in fact, this type of cake was invented by Sam German, a chocolate maker that had contributed to the development of dark baking chocolate, that of which is used in the recipe of this confectionery delight.

INGREDIENTS:

 

Cake

 

1 box Betty Crocker® SuperMoist® German chocolate cake mix

1 1/4 cup water

1/2 cup vegetable oil

3 eggs

1 bottle (1 oz) red food color

1 tablespoon baking cocoa

 

Frosting

 

1 1/2 cups white vanilla baking chips

2 1/4 cups Betty Crocker® Rich & Creamy vanilla frosting (from two 1-lb containers)

 

DIRECTIONS:

 

1. Heat oven to 350°F (325°F for dark or nonstick pans). Grease or spray bottoms only of two 8-inch round cake pans. In large bowl, beat cake ingredients with electric mixer on low speed 30 seconds; beat on medium speed 2 minutes. Pour into pans.

 

2. Bake and cool as directed on box for 8-inch rounds. Slice each cake layer in half horizontally to make a total of 4 layers.

 

3. In medium microwavable bowl, microwave baking chips uncovered on Medium (50%) 4 to 5 minutes, stirring halfway through microwave time. Stir until smooth; cool 5 minutes. Stir in frosting until well blended. Place 1 cake layer, cut side up, on serving plate; spread with 1 cup of the frosting. Repeat with second and third cake layers. Top with remaining cake layer, cut side down; frost with remaining frosting.

This cake gets its chocolate flavor from actual chocolate instead of cocoa powder. It was named after American Samuel German, who developed the dark chocolate used for baking. A distinctive feature of this cake is the frosting of coconut and crushed pecans.

 

In keeping with the American way, I followed Kraft's recipe to a tee and even used Baker's German chocolate bar. The only deviation is icing chocolate Italian buttercream on the sides, to keep the cake moist.
